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
222 MELLIS ROAD Semi-Detached £390,000 19 Feb 2021
223 MELLIS ROAD Semi-Detached £134,500 23 Jul 1998
225 MELLIS ROAD Detached £87,000 28 Jul 1995
THE OLD RECTORY MELLIS ROAD Detached £525,000 19 Oct 2007